Kampala — THE Africa Development Fund is to fund a consultant for a Sexual and Reproductive Health programme.
The programme is under the Health Sector Strategic Plan Project (HSSPP 2). The African Development Fund is the lending arm of the African Development Bank (AfDB).
"The Ministry of Health has set a target for the health system performance through the Health Service Strategic Plan 2 (2005/2010) and sub-sectoral targets. The districts and lower administrative and community levels must translate the programme into reality on the ground."
"So, the HSSPP2 (2007/2012) will carry out reproductive health interventions in 10 districts of south-western Uganda and mental health interventions throughout Uganda spearheaded by a technical assistant," a procurement website said.
The health consultant will lead implementation of a training programme in the districts and coordinate mechanisms to scale up the roadmap of accelerating reduction of maternal, natal mortality and probity.
